O’Reilly Auto Parts New Title Sponsor of NASCAR Xfinity Series

Charlotte, N.C. – O’Reilly Auto Parts will take over as the title sponsor of NASCAR’s second-tier national series, marking the renaming of the Xfinity Series for next season. The multi-year sponsorship agreement, announced this Monday, includes promotional opportunities and brand integrations with The CW Network, the exclusive broadcast partner of the series. The name change will take effect on January 1st.

Partnering with NASCAR and The CW at this level allows us to further deepen our connection with one of the most loyal fan bases in all of sports.

Hugo Sanchez, Vice President of Advertising and Marketing at O’Reilly
O’Reilly becomes the fourth primary sponsor in the series’ history. It was launched as the Busch Series in 1982, had a seven-year stint with Nationwide Insurance, and Xfinity has been the primary sponsor for the last 11 years.

O’Reilly Auto Parts was founded in Springfield, Missouri, in 1957 as a single store and today is an auto parts powerhouse with more than 6,400 locations in 48 states, Puerto Rico, Mexico, and Canada. For several years it was the main sponsor of NASCAR races in Daytona, Texas, and Mid-Ohio.
